Average Social and Community Service Managers Salary in Bangor, ME

The average salary for Social and Community Service Managerss in Bangor, ME is $71,610. While this is lower than the national average, the cost of living in Bangor, ME may offset the difference, preserving real purchasing power. Notably, Bangor, ME is a key hub for this profession, with a job concentration 1.96x higher than average.

Social and Community Service Managers Salary Distribution in Bangor, ME

The earning potential for Social and Community Service Managerss in Bangor, ME var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$49,880,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$95,520.

How much does a Social and Community Service Managers make in Bangor, ME?

The median annual salary for a Social and Community Service Managers in Bangor, ME is $71,610. This typically ranges from $49,880 for entry-level positions to $95,520 for top-level roles.

How does the salary compare to the national average?

The average salary for this role in Bangor, ME is 12.6% lower than the national median of $81,940.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 180 employees in the Bangor, ME area with a job density of 2.487 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
